$10K Desert Rip-Off Build

So, I just bought a Silver 2018 TRD Off Road. Replaced the 2006 4Runner I've had for the past 10 years. Here in Arizona, the dealers have their own version of a "Desert Off Road" package. At the first dealer it was $7500. Included TRD wheels, Toyo A/T tires, steps, badge black outs and a lift kit. Not suspension, a freakin' spacer kit. The 2nd dealer it was $10k. Included TRD wheels, BFG tires, steps, TRD suspension, TRD front grill, and maybe a skid plate. I'll admit, the second dealer at least included better suspension and good tires, but not for $10k. I really liked the way they looked with those packages, so I'm just doing everything myself. So here is my basic "build" that saves me over $7k.....

I installed a pedal commander. Huge difference. Took away the flat mushy pedal that makes these cars feel like a pig. Got it used locally for $200. Well worth it and my mpg's actually went up by a tenth.


Front and Rear TRD suspension. This suspension is great! The stock ride felt "jittery." It was too bouncy and unsettled. My 06 had Bilsteins, so I was probably just used to a good ride. I bought the discontinued FJ kit, so it was only $570 shipped. I went with this to avoid a warranty issues with the dealership. I can also go with a higher bilstein lift down the road for something different. Really good improvement and I like the red springs and reservoir on back shocks. Just looks cool.

No, installed myself. It's not bad at all. Neighbor helped me. Took my time, about an hour per side in the front since I switched out the top hats. Back was easy too. Took me a little bit to figure out how to orient the reservoir and everything. It's soooo nice working on suspension on a brand new car. Everything is so clean; all the bolts come right off.
